I'm looking for a pattern that is like a tube and holds plastic bags. The one I've seen hangs and can be quilted or not quilted. I've also seen one that looks like a doll and the bags are removed from the back of her dress. Do any of you know where I can find some kind of pattern for this? I have plastic bags everywhere!!!!

My mom has one that is made from a kitchen towel. Sew the long sides together to make a long tube. Turn the ends of the tube over to make a casing for elastic. Add a hanging loop to one end so it can be hung.

I just used a hand towel. I sewed pockets on each end, threaded an old set of shoe laces in each end then sewed up the long side. tighted up the shoe laces and used that as a hanger.

You can also use a sleeve from an old shirt too. Just cut off the sleeve and make a casing at the top of the sleeve and add a loop for hanging and there ya go. Have a great day, Huggies, Fay

Someone gave me one made from 2 place mats. They were sewn together on the long sides with spaces left on top and bottom for putting bags in and taking out and a small handle on top for hanging.
